titleOfInvention OIL COMPOSITION FOR REFRIGERATOR
abstract A refrigerating machine oil composition which comprises a base oil comprising a mineral oil and/or a synthetic oil and, compounded therewith, (a) a partial ester of a polyhydric alcohol with a fatty acid and (b) an acid phosphoric ester or an amine salt thereof; and a refrigerating machine oil composition which comprises a base oil comprising a mineral oil and/or a synthetic oil and, compounded therewith, (a) an acid phosphoric ester or an amine salt thereof, (b) an alkylene oxide adduct of an acetylenic glycol, (c) the potassium salt of a fatty acid, etc., (d) an organic acid, and (e) a fatty acide amide, etc. The compositions have excellent lubricating performace and produce a satisfactory friction-reducing effect in either an oily region or an extreme pressure region, especially in friction between an aluminum material and an iron material.
